body { background: #ff9900; margin: 0em; }
table { font: .75em verdana; margin: 0; } 
td { text-align: center; }
td.other { text-align: justify; }
td.links { text-align: left; }

h1 { line-height: .25em; margin: 0em; color: #ffcc99; font: bold small-caps; text-align: left; }
h2 { line-height: 1em; margin: 0em; color: #ffcc99; font: bold; text-align: right; }
h2.ca { line-height: .25em; margin: 0em; color: #ffcc99; font: bold; text-align: right; }
h1.home { color: #ffcc99; font: bold; 1.25em; text-align: center; }
p { text-align: justify; line-height: 1.5em; }
p.date { color: #cc99cc; }
p.play { text-align: justify; line-height: 1.5em; margin: .5em 0em 0em 0em; }
p.announce { text-align: left; font: bold; 1.25em; margin: 0em; }
p.airing { margin: 0; color: #cc0000; font: bold 1.2em; }
p.sl { text-align: center; font: bold; 1.25em;  }
p.homelinks { text-align: right; align: baseline; line-height: 1.75em; }
p.links { text-align: left; align: baseline; line-height: 1.75em; }
a:link { text-decoration: none; color: #ffffcc; }
a:visited { text-decoration: none; color: #ffffcc; }
a:hover { text-decoration: none; color: #99ff99; }
img.inline { margin: .5em 0em 2em 2em; }
ul li { list-style-image: url("circle.gif"); line-height: 1.5em; text-align: justify; }

hr { color: #ffcc99; height: 5px; }